27 #ifndef FREEDRENO_SCREEN_H_
28 #define FREEDRENO_SCREEN_H_
29
30 #include "drm/freedreno_drmif.h"
31 #include "drm/freedreno_ringbuffer.h"
32
33 #include "pipe/p_screen.h"
34 #include "util/u_memory.h"
35 #include "util/slab.h"
36 #include "os/os_thread.h"
37
38 #include "freedreno_batch_cache.h"
39 #include "freedreno_perfcntr.h"
40 #include "freedreno_util.h"
41
42 struct fd_bo;
43
44 struct fd_screen {
45 struct pipe_screen base;
46
47 mtx_t lock;
48
49 /* it would be tempting to use pipe_reference here, but that
50 * really doesn't work well if it isn't the first member of
51 * the struct, so not quite so awesome to be adding refcnting
52 * further down the inheritance hierarchy:
53 */
54 int refcnt;
55
56 /* place for winsys to stash it's own stuff: */
57 void *winsys_priv;
58
59 struct slab_parent_pool transfer_pool;
60
61 uint32_t gmemsize_bytes;
62 uint32_t device_id;
63 uint32_t gpu_id; /* 220, 305, etc */
64 uint32_t chip_id; /* coreid:8 majorrev:8 minorrev:8 patch:8 */
65 uint32_t max_freq;
66 uint32_t ram_size;
67 uint32_t max_rts; /* max # of render targets */
68 uint32_t gmem_alignw, gmem_alignh;
69 uint32_t num_vsc_pipes;
70 uint32_t priority_mask;
71 bool has_timestamp;
72
73 unsigned num_perfcntr_groups;
74 const struct fd_perfcntr_group *perfcntr_groups;
75
76 /* generated at startup from the perfcntr groups: */
77 unsigned num_perfcntr_queries;
78 struct pipe_driver_query_info *perfcntr_queries;
79
80 void *compiler; /* currently unused for a2xx */
81
82 struct fd_device *dev;
83
84 /* NOTE: we still need a pipe associated with the screen in a few
85 * places, like screen->get_timestamp(). For anything context
86 * related, use ctx->pipe instead.
87 */
88 struct fd_pipe *pipe;
89
90 uint32_t (*setup_slices)(struct fd_resource *rsc);
91 unsigned (*tile_mode)(const struct pipe_resource *prsc);
92
93 int64_t cpu_gpu_time_delta;
94
95 struct fd_batch_cache batch_cache;
96
97 bool reorder;
98
99 uint16_t rsc_seqno;
100
101 unsigned num_supported_modifiers;
102 const uint64_t *supported_modifiers;
103 };
104
105 static inline struct fd_screen *
106 fd_screen(struct pipe_screen *pscreen)
107 {
108 return (struct fd_screen *)pscreen;
109 }
110
111 boolean fd_screen_bo_get_handle(struct pipe_screen *pscreen,
112 struct fd_bo *bo,
113 unsigned stride,
114 struct winsys_handle *whandle);
115 struct fd_bo * fd_screen_bo_from_handle(struct pipe_screen *pscreen,
116 struct winsys_handle *whandle);
117
118 struct pipe_screen * fd_screen_create(struct fd_device *dev);
119
120 static inline boolean
121 is_a20x(struct fd_screen *screen)
122 {
123 return (screen->gpu_id >= 200) && (screen->gpu_id < 210);
124 }
125
126 /* is a3xx patch revision 0? */
127 /* TODO a306.0 probably doesn't need this.. be more clever?? */
128 static inline boolean
129 is_a3xx_p0(struct fd_screen *screen)
130 {
131 return (screen->chip_id & 0xff0000ff) == 0x03000000;
132 }
133
134 static inline boolean
135 is_a3xx(struct fd_screen *screen)
136 {
137 return (screen->gpu_id >= 300) && (screen->gpu_id < 400);
138 }
139
140 static inline boolean
141 is_a4xx(struct fd_screen *screen)
142 {
143 return (screen->gpu_id >= 400) && (screen->gpu_id < 500);
144 }
145
146 static inline boolean
147 is_a5xx(struct fd_screen *screen)
148 {
149 return (screen->gpu_id >= 500) && (screen->gpu_id < 600);
150 }
151
152 static inline boolean
153 is_a6xx(struct fd_screen *screen)
154 {
155 return (screen->gpu_id >= 600) && (screen->gpu_id < 700);
156 }
157
158 /* is it using the ir3 compiler (shader isa introduced with a3xx)? */
159 static inline boolean
160 is_ir3(struct fd_screen *screen)
161 {
162 return is_a3xx(screen) || is_a4xx(screen) || is_a5xx(screen) || is_a6xx(screen);
163 }
164
165 static inline bool
166 has_compute(struct fd_screen *screen)
167 {
168 return is_a5xx(screen);
169 }
170
